Z.P. Cluster School Boys, a government-run primary school located in the rural area of Sakri block, Dhule district, Maharashtra, stands as a testament to the commitment to primary education in the region. Established in 1900 and managed by the local body, the school plays a vital role in educating young boys in the community.
Infrastructure and Facilities: The school boasts a sturdy pucca building, comprising eight well-maintained classrooms designed for effective instruction. Electricity ensures a conducive learning environment, while a functional tap water system provides clean drinking water for students. A dedicated playground fosters physical activity and recreation, complementing the academic curriculum. The school's library, stocked with 250 books, encourages a love for reading and expands learning beyond the classroom. Importantly, the school is accessible to all, including students with disabilities, thanks to the provision of ramps.
Academic Structure and Curriculum: Catering exclusively to boys, the school offers primary education from classes 1 to 4, teaching in Marathi. The school emphasizes a strong foundation in core subjects. While it currently lacks a pre-primary section, its focus remains firmly on providing quality primary education. The school's commitment to academic excellence is further underscored by the presence of two male teachers who provide dedicated instruction. The mid-day meal program, prepared on the school premises, addresses nutritional needs, ensuring students are well-nourished and ready to learn.
Technological Resources and Learning Environment: The school embraces technology with a single functional computer, though computer-aided learning programs are yet to be implemented.
